Answer:

The maximum width of the pool must be 38 ft

Step-by-step explanation:

Let

y -----> the length of the swimming pool

x ----> the width of the swimming pool

The perimeter of the swimming pool is

P=2(x+y)

we have

y=22\ ft

substitute

P=2(x+22)

P=2x+44

Remember that

The perimeter of the pool must be no more than 120 feet

so

The inequality that represent this scenario is

2x+44 \leq 120

Solve for x

2x \leq 120-44

2x \leq 76

x \leq 38\ ft

therefore

The maximum width of the pool must be 38 ft
